Gathering the Necessary Tools
Before starting the repair, gather essential tools to ensure a smooth process. You will need a small screwdriver set, a plastic spudger, and a replacement screen compatible with your laptop model. Having these tools on hand will streamline your repair experience.
Choosing the Right Replacement Screen
To find the correct replacement screen, check your laptop's model number. This information is usually located on the bottom of the laptop or under the battery. Use this number to search for a compatible screen online.

Removing the Old Screen
Once you have the necessary tools and replacement screen, it's time to remove the old one. Follow these steps carefully:
- Power off the laptop and remove the battery if possible.
- Gently pry off the bezel around the screen using the plastic spudger.
- Unscrew the screws securing the screen to the hinges.
- Disconnect the video cable carefully, ensuring not to damage it.

Installing the New Screen
With the old screen removed, you can now install the new screen. Here's how:
- Connect the video cable to the new screen securely.
- Align the screen with the hinges and screw it into place.
- Reattach the bezel, ensuring it snaps back into position.
Testing the New Screen
Before fully reassembling your laptop, it's crucial to test the new screen. Reinsert the battery, power on the laptop, and check for display issues. If everything looks good, proceed to secure all components.
